Leaders of the notorious Russian mercenary group Wagner are believed to have died in a plane crash north of Moscow just a few months after what appears to have been a rebellion against Russian president Vladimir Putin. Fyre Festival returns, with no sign of Ja Rule. In a big week for space, both India and China attempt moon landings. All this and more in this week's strange news segment.

Assault and Murder: The Grand Conspiracy of Military Cover-ups
1:01:39

CLASSIC: Foreign Investment and the Housing Crisis
1:19:52

Strange News: Havana Syndrome is Back, the Newest Noma Scandal, Iran and More
1:15:55